Output 72006fa8a4ece8ca4ceb5d6251492f31658d00a77a65e3fba94ef7e6c17f16d6:0

value
22405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d220864b01044e74f9ea3244cf0ca032be5f1037 OP_EQUAL
address
3Lr4ng9MkzgXhiZMY7yg51Mm62PScusWqY
transaction
72006fa8a4ece8ca4ceb5d6251492f31658d00a77a65e3fba94ef7e6c17f16d6
spent
true